Do I Need to Notify Tenants Before Window Cleaning?

Yes, in most cases, landlords and property managers should notify tenants before window cleaning takes place, particularly where cleaners will be working at height near windows, accessing communal areas, or entering the property to clean interior windows. How to Prevent Limescale Buildup on Glass Buildings

Limescale buildup on glass buildings can affect appearance, reduce natural light, and make surfaces harder to clean over time. Preventing it early is key to maintaining a professional look for offices, retail spaces, and commercial properties. Do Commercial Window Cleaners Need a Licence in London?

If you’re managing a commercial property in London, you might wonder whether hiring a window cleaning company requires any licences. The answer depends on the type of work and location.
